The SPE-KSU student chapter is a member of the international SPE and SPE-KSA in Dhahran. The Society of Petroleum Engineers (SPE) is a global non-profit technical and professional organization. The SPE-KSU student chapter was established in 2002 to improve SPE student membership and future Saudi Arabia Section membership. The main objectives of the SPE-KSU chapter is to improve the knowledge of students in the oil and gas sectors through different activities such as seminars, meetings and field trips to the oil and gas industry, to establish communication with oil and gas industry, to strengthen the relations with other SPE chapters especially in the Gulf countries, to encourage faculty member to participate in national and international SPE conferences and also to provide information related to petroleum and gas engineering science for interested individuals on our chapter.
Additionally, the SPE-KSU assists and provides support to the annual SPE technical symposium, which is organized by the SPE-KSA in Dhahran (www.speksa.org)
